Ingredients

1 1/2 cups cider vinegar
1 cup chopped onion
1 large tart apple - peeled , cored and chopped
1 cup golden raisins
3/4 cup white sugar
1/4 cup lemon juice
1 green chile pepper , chopped
1 tablespoon minced fresh ginger root
1 tablespoon lemon zest
1 teaspoon ground coriander seed
1/8 teaspoon ground cloves
2 1/2 Fuyu persimmons , peeled and chopped

Instructions

1.In a medium-sized pot, combine the cider vinegar, chopped onion, chopped tart apple, golden raisins, white sugar, lemon juice, chopped green chilli pepper, minced ginger root, lemon zest, ground coriander seed, and ground cloves.
2.Bring the mixture to a boil over medium-high heat, stirring frequently.
3.Reduce the heat and let the mixture simmer for about 45 minutes, stirring occasionally.
4.Add the chopped persimmons to the pot and continue to simmer the chutney until the fruit is soft and the mixture has thickened.
5.Remove from heat and cool to room temperature.
6.Serve as a condiment with crackers, cheese, meat, or any other foods as desired.
